ZIP 47160 and ZIP 47167 are ZIP Code areas in Indiana.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 47167 has the higher population (15,573 vs 67 in ZIP 47160). ZIP 47160 has the higher median household income ($76,250 vs $57,697 in ZIP 47167). ZIP 47167 has the higher median home value ($161,500 vs $116,700 in ZIP 47160).
